Juneteenth Concert
Sun Jun 23, 2024
2:30pm to 3:30pm ET
Age: All Ages
Price: FREE
Location:
Blue Hills Fire Department
You are invited to an all-ages, live, in-person concert in celebration of Juneteenth.
Entertaining your family will be the award-winning Lost Tribe Band.
Libraries, schools, and museums throughout the U.S. have enjoyed working with The Ray of Hope Project to create performance pieces that connect today's social issues to those of 19th-century enslaved people and abolitionists. The ultimate goal of this project is to help people connect with history to explore their own sense of freedom and responsibility for today's social justice issues, and to use this exploration to affect positive change in our world.
